Private Trust Co. NA lessened its holdings in iShares U.S. Technology ETF (NYSEARCA:IYW – Free Report) by 6.5% during the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 9,497 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after selling 655 shares during the period. Private Trust Co. NA’s holdings in iShares U.S. Technology ETF were worth $1,646,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About iShares U.S. Technology ETF
iShares U.S. Technology ETF, formerly iShares Dow Jones U.S. Technology Sector Index Fund (the Fund) is a non-diversified fund. The Fund se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the Dow Jones U.S. Technology Index (the Index).
